Full Job Description
JOB MISSION:
Create and maintain multi-season directed product assortments of New Balance Apparel and Accessories that serve US DTC Channels and consumers across NB.com, Inline/Outlet B&M, and deliver on key strategic Brand initiatives and performance KPIs. Work in close partnership with Commercial Buying and Planning teams to validate line architecture and assortment shape/share and to ensure directed assortment execution. Contribute to the planning and execution of Merchandising-related go-to-market deliverables and stage-gates in partnership with the Regional Business Unit Merchants (RBU) and Key Account Merchant (KAM) partners.

MAJOR ACCOUNTABILITIES:
  • Adopt and adapt Global and Regional product assortments to meet and exceed region and channel goals.
  • Establish directed assortments (DAs) that deliver right product, right time, right place, right quantities by channel.
  • Balance the 'art and science' of merchandising incorporating sell-in/sell-thru data with future-facing consumer/trend insights.
  • Lead / influence seasonal Apparel and Accessories strategies and regional priorities as applicable.
  • Advocate for DTC assortment needs through RBU and KAM collaboration.
  • Ensure retail peak aligned, compelling head-to-toe consumer experience through cross-category / cross functional partnership
  • Actively manage and communicate assortment modifications, ensuring data integrity and best in class execution.
  • Serve DTC commercial team stakeholders as go-to point of contact for category assortment-related needs.

About New Balance Athletics, Inc.

New Balance Athletics, Inc. is a footwear company that specializes in athletic shoes and apparel. The company was founded in 1906 by William J. Riley and has since grown to become one of the largest athletic shoe manufacturers in the world. New Balance is known for its focus on quality and innovation, and has been recognized for its commitment to domestic manufacturing. The company operates five factories in the United States and has a reputation for producing high-quality, durable shoes. New Balance offers a wide range of products, including running shoes, walking shoes, and lifestyle shoes, as well as apparel and accessories. The company is committed to sustainability and has implemented a number of initiatives to reduce its environmental impact.
